导读:
1. Redis消息队列是一种利用Redis存储和传递消息的方式,可以将消息存储在Redis中,并在不同应用之间进行消息传输。
2. Redis消息队列的优势在于它的性能、可靠性、易用性和可扩展性,可以满足大多数企业的消息传输需求。
3. 本文将详细介绍Redis消息队列的原理、特性、应用场景和架构,以及如何使用Redis消息队列来提高企业的消息传输效率。
正文:
1. Redis消息队列是一种利用Redis存储和传递消息的方式,它可以将消息存储在Redis中,并在不同应用之间进行消息传输。Redis消息队列可以实现消息的发布和订阅,也可以实现消息的排队和处理。
2. Redis消息队列具有良好的性能、可靠性、易用性和可扩展性,可以满足大多数企业的消息传输需求。Redis消息队列可以支持高吞吐量的消息处理,还可以支持多种传输协议,例如TCP/IP、RESTful API 等。
3. Redis消息队列的应用场景包括缓存同步、集群管理、数据同步、消息通知等,可以满足企业级应用的消息传输需求。Redis消息队列的架构包括生产者、消费者和消息服务器三部分,生产者用于发布消息,消费者用于接收和处理消息,消息服务器用于存储消息。
4. 如果要使用Redis消息队列,可以使用Redis的内置命令发布消息,也可以使用Redis的客户端库来发布消息,还可以使用Redis的监听功能来接收消息。此外,还可以使用Redis的Lua脚本来管理消息队列,以实现更高效、可靠的消息传输。
总结:
Redis消息队列是一种利用Redis存储和传递消息的方式,具有良好的性能、可靠